Output 7631d271dc0b564c1e0e6ab2080e4ed2514ce16ec8e064a7ef29ceb20378736a:0

value
1018656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10cc166d973b90a5ccd98dd62b9809b441713a3e OP_EQUAL
address
33DqDsLmGyaQzutApMJPx4ChmVjN2xz3Zs
transaction
7631d271dc0b564c1e0e6ab2080e4ed2514ce16ec8e064a7ef29ceb20378736a
spent
true